The Shinein - Single
Skream's "The Shinein - Single" emerges as a finely crafted piece of electronic music, showcasing the artist's deft ability to blend deep house rhythms with a dubstep sensibility. Released in 2009, this track exemplifies the sonic experimentation that characterized the late 2000s electronic scene, a period marked by the convergence of various genres and influences. The production is meticulous, layering warm synths with a buoyant bassline that drives the track forward. The tempo maintains a steady pulse, inviting listeners to lose themselves in its hypnotic groove. Skream employs a rich tapestry of textures, using airy vocal samples that weave in and out, creating an ethereal quality that contrasts with the more grounded, syncopated beats. These elements come together to form a sound that is both immersive and danceable, a hallmark of Skream's style. Distinctively, "The Shinein" captures the essence of a transitional moment in electronic music, where the boundaries between genres begin to blur. It reflects the growing influence of dubstep in club culture while retaining the melodic sensibilities of house. Key moments in the track, such as the subtle build-ups and breakdowns, reveal Skream's keen ear for dynamics, keeping the listener engaged throughout. In the context of its era, this single resonates with the ethos of exploration and innovation that defined electronic music in the late 2000s, making it a noteworthy addition to any collection for those seeking to understand the evolution of the genre.
